/**
* Fetches recommendations and extra data about the version. Doesn't actually check if it's been imported.
* @param gameId
* @param versionName
* @returns
*/
async fetchUnimportedVersionInformation(gameId: string, versionName: string) {
const game = await prisma.game.findUnique({
where: { id: gameId },
select: { libraryPath: true, libraryId: true, mName: true },
});
if (!game || !game.libraryId) return undefined;
const library = this.libraries.get(game.libraryId);
if (!library) return undefined;
const fileExts: { [key: string]: string[] } = {
Linux: [
// Ext for Unity games
".x86_64",
// Shell scripts
".sh",
// No extension is common for Linux binaries
"",
// AppImages
".appimage",
],
Windows: [".exe", ".bat"],
macOS: [
// App files
".app",
],
};
const options: Array<{
filename: string;
platform: string;
match: number;
}> = [];
const files = await library.versionReaddir(game.libraryPath, versionName);
for (const filename of files) {
const basename = path.basename(filename);
const dotLocation = filename.lastIndexOf(".");
const ext =
dotLocation == -1 ? "" : filename.slice(dotLocation).toLowerCase();
for (const [platform, checkExts] of Object.entries(fileExts)) {
for (const checkExt of checkExts) {
if (checkExt != ext) continue;
const fuzzyValue = fuzzy(basename, game.mName);
options.push({
filename: filename.replaceAll(" ", "\\ "),
platform,
match: fuzzyValue,
});
}
}
}
const sortedOptions = options.sort((a, b) => b.match - a.match);
return sortedOptions;
}
